Verse of the Day

Luke 16:19
There was a certain rich man, which was clothed in purple and fine linen, and fared sumptuously every day:
Reflections On The Scripture: This passage reminds us that material wealth is not a reflection of our spiritual worth. The rich man, adorned in purple fine linen and enjoying the finest fare, presents a picture of earthly success. But we must keep in mind that our true wealth distinctly lies in our faith and our relationship with God. Physical riches, luxuries, and the grandeur of worldly life are fleeting, and they should not distract us from our true purpose. Never let earthly wealth conceal or diminish your spiritual wealth. Great is the person who is rich in faith and love for God, for his treasure is everlasting.
